Grant Description
This is a Notice of Intent to award to the Oregon Department of Fish and Wildlife. Parties to this agreement will coordinate an effort between the Lahontan National Fish Hatchery Complex (LNFHC) and Oregon Department of Fish and Wildlife to implement a statistically rigorous survey to evaluate distribution and abundance of age 1+ Lahontan cutthroat trout in Willow and Whitehorse Creeks of Coyote Lake basin.
